Pure membership designs are fading. The (a low base subscription cost + usage charges) is becoming the gold standard. This lines up the supplier's success with the customer's success. If the consumer does not use the tool, they pay less. This reduces churn however puts pressure on the supplier to provide immediate worth.

Companies are having a hard time to stabilize the high expense of GPU calculate with competitive prices. We are seeing "AI Add-ons" (e.g., paying an extra $20/month/user for AI functions) rather than bundling AI into the base rate. This protects margins while providing advanced capabilities to power users. Unlike Horizontal SaaS (general tools like Slack), Vertical SaaS includes industry-specific compliance, workflows, and terminology out of the box.

A SaaS financial model is specified as a spreadsheet-based structure that forecasts a membership service's earnings, expenditures, and capital by integrating an operating design (P&L, balance sheet, capital), earnings forecasting based upon MRR and churn metrics, and comprehensive working with strategies to help creators make data-driven decisions.
